Ticket: Staging env misconfigured for Siftgate bloom filter

The bloom layer in front of the Pellet KV store is rejecting all lookups in staging because the env file was copied from the dev template without credentials. False-positive tuning values are fine; only the auth line is missing. To unblock the weekly demo, the Pellet admission secret must be set on the following line.

env line for yaguf-fajop: LEDGER_TOKEN13=fb08984397349

Subject: Quickstore 4.2 — bloom filter now fronts the KV layer

Plugin authors: starting with this release, Quickstore places a bloom filter ahead of the key-value store. Negative lookups return faster; false positives fall through safely. No API changes are required on your side. Verify your plugin against the staging build referenced below.

session token of fahif-tadup = htk3_9c7

## Artifact Signing — ReminderSpool

The clinic appointment reminder job (ReminderSpool) ships as a signed container. The Medrota scheduler refuses unsigned images. Sign during the publish stage; never sign locally. Rotation happens quarterly — update this page when it does. Verification failures block deploys hard, by design. Keep the passphrase in the vault, not in scripts. For maintainers needing to re-sign after a hotfix, the deploy key is:

rollout seal: bky4_CTqF

Management Meeting Minutes — Customer Concentration Risk

Attendees reviewed exposure to Drossmere Retail, now 41% of revenue across the Halberton branches. Agreed actions: diversify mid-tier accounts, cap new credit extensions to Drossmere, and report concentration monthly. Branch managers to nominate two target accounts each by month-end. Mira Stenlow will coordinate. The related plan is recorded in the note below.

board note of kageg-bahof: The renewal with Holwynax Holdings closes at $2 million a year, 5 percent below the last contract. Project Ulaath slips by two quarters because of the supplier delay.